Abstract The low-lying dipole states, known as Pygmy Dipole Resonances (PDR) have been studied at length for several nuclei and isotopes. Many properties acquired understood by the theoretical experimental studies of isovector isoscalar response PDR. Nevertheless, some unresolved questions still remain two them are briefly discussed in this contribution: long standing question about collective nature new mode presence PDR deformed nuclei.

The isovector dipole response in Pb is described in the framework of a fully self-consistent relativistic random phase approximation. The NL3 parameter set for the effective mean-field Lagrangian with nonlinear meson self-interaction terms, used in the present calculations, reproduces ground state properties as well as the excitation energies of giant resonances in nuclei.
